Abstract
Nowadays, with the increasing use of composite materials, lightning indirect effects on aircraft are an important problem of interest. Currents and voltages induced by the lightning strike can perturb the equipment working. The purpose of this study is to develop a numerical tool allowing the estimation of current coupling on wires involved by the lightning strike. The model permits to consider several thousands of wires and is a powerful and useful tool, assisting the aircraft manufacturer in the certification process.
